What is Railing Iron?

Railing iron describes metal made use of in creating railings, mostly wrought iron or customized iron work. These materials supply high toughness and can be formed into intricate designs.

Types of Railing Iron

    Wrought Iron: Understood for its toughness and malleability, enabling fancy designs. Cast Iron: Heavier than functioned iron however usually utilized for its distinctive appearances. Stainless Steel: Modern aesthetic with superb deterioration resistance.

Safety Functions in Barrier Design

Safety should never be jeopardized when choosing railing iron:

Height Requirements

Most building ordinance need barriers to be at the very least 36 inches high on domestic staircases.

Spacing In between Spindles

Typically no greater than 4 inches apart to stop kids from slipping through.

Maintenance Tips for Wrought Iron Work

Proper care will certainly lengthen the life of your railing:

1. Routine Cleaning

Use mild soap and water; stay clear of rough cleaners that can damage surfaces.

2. Evaluate Annually

Look for indications of corrosion or wear; retouch paint as necessary.
